Why Students Continue Choosing Computer Science Engineering

Several factors contribute to the continued popularity of Computer Science Engineering.

Strong Industry Demand

Almost every organization now depends on software, cloud platforms, artificial intelligence, cybersecurity, automation, and digital infrastructure.

High Placement Opportunities

Top technology companies recruit Computer Science graduates every year for software development, cloud computing, AI, cybersecurity, DevOps, and data engineering roles.

Global Career Opportunities

Computer Science graduates find employment not only in India but also in countries including:

  • USA
  • Canada
  • Germany
  • Australia
  • Singapore
  • United Kingdom
  • UAE

Multiple Career Paths

Unlike many engineering branches, CSE provides flexibility to move into numerous technical and managerial roles.


Evolution of Computer Science Engineering

Earlier, Computer Science focused mainly on programming and software development.

Today, the field includes:

  • Artificial Intelligence
  • Machine Learning
  • Cloud Computing
  • Data Science
  • Cyber Security
  • Blockchain
  • Internet of Things (IoT)
  • Robotics
  • AR/VR
  • Quantum Computing
  • Edge Computing
  • Big Data Analytics

This continuous expansion keeps Computer Science Engineering relevant and future-ready.

Career Opportunities After Computer Science Engineering

Graduates can pursue roles such as:

Software Developer

Develop applications, enterprise software, and digital products.

Full Stack Developer

Handle both front-end and back-end development.

AI Engineer

Develop intelligent systems and machine learning applications.

Data Scientist

Analyze large datasets to derive business insights.

Cloud Engineer

Manage cloud infrastructure and deployment.

Cyber Security Engineer

Protect systems against cyber threats.

DevOps Engineer

Automate software development and deployment.

Mobile App Developer

Build Android and iOS applications.

Blockchain Developer

Create decentralized applications and secure digital systems.

Game Developer

Develop interactive gaming platforms and experiences.


Emerging Technologies Driving CSE Demand

The future of Computer Science is being shaped by cutting-edge technologies.

Artificial Intelligence

AI is transforming healthcare, finance, manufacturing, and customer service.


Machine Learning

ML enables systems to learn from data and improve performance automatically.


Cloud Computing

Businesses increasingly rely on cloud infrastructure for scalability and efficiency.


Cyber Security

Growing cyber threats have made security professionals essential.


Internet of Things

Connected devices create demand for embedded systems and intelligent software.


Data Science

Organizations leverage data-driven insights for strategic decision-making.


Quantum Computing

An emerging field expected to revolutionize complex computational tasks.

How to Choose the Right CSE College

Selecting the right engineering college significantly impacts career growth.

Consider:

  • AICTE Approval
  • NAAC Accreditation
  • Experienced Faculty
  • Modern Computer Labs
  • Industry Partnerships
  • Internship Opportunities
  • Placement Support
  • Research Facilities
  • Innovation Centers
  • Coding Culture
  • Alumni Network
  • Industry Certifications
